"A man is being sued by a New Hampshire company for labeling it a spammer and reporting its actions to ISPs, after two years of allegedly receiving unsolicited emails from it. Atriks alleges that Jay Stuler caused financial damage to the firm, resulting in a number of lost contracts. The suit also says that Stuler made defamatory statements against the company, calling it 'a notorious spam gang,' and CEO Brian Haberstroh a 'criminal,' which the suit denies." ("Company Sues over Spam Claims", TheWhir/Article Central, Jan. 20; Jo Best, "Spammed man sued by alleged spammer wants cash", Silicon.com/The Spam Report, Jan. 18)(via KipEsquire who got it from Privacy Spot).
Alleged spammer sues spam-complainer
